Exploring the World of IP Geolocation APIs: Your Guide to Free IP Geolocation Services

Exploring the World of IP Geolocation APIs: Your Guide to Free IP Geolocation Services
4 min read
08 September 2023

In the ever-connected digital landscape, knowing the geographical location of users interacting with your web applications or services can be a game-changer. IP Geolocation is the technology that empowers you to determine the physical location of a device or user based on their IP address. This invaluable data can enhance user experiences, improve security measures, and provide valuable insights for your business. While there are paid IP Geolocation services available, there's also a world of free IP Geolocation APIs waiting to be explored. In this article, we'll dive into the realm of free IP Geolocation APIs, uncovering their benefits and how to get started with them.

The Power of IP Geolocation

IP Geolocation offers a treasure trove of advantages for businesses and developers:

1. Personalized User Experiences: By knowing a user's location, you can customize content, language, and even offerings to cater to their specific region.

2. Enhanced Security: Detect and mitigate threats by identifying the geographic origin of suspicious activities, helping you protect your services and users.

3. Analytics Insights: Gain a deeper understanding of your user base by analyzing location data, which can inform your business decisions and marketing strategies.

4. Compliance: Ensure compliance with regional regulations and data privacy laws by tailoring your services to user locations.

Free IP Geolocation APIs

While paid IP Geolocation services offer extensive features and premium support, free IP Geolocation APIs can be a great starting point for small projects, testing, or getting familiar with IP Geolocation technology. Here are some notable free IP Geolocation APIs:

1. ipinfo.io:

  • Features: Provides location data including city, region, country, latitude, longitude, and more.
  • Usage: Free tier with limited requests per day, paid plans available for higher usage.

2. ipstack:

  • Features: Offers location information, time zone data, currency details, and more.
  • Usage: Free plan available with limited requests per month, paid plans for expanded usage.

3. MaxMind GeoLite2:

  • Features: Provides city-level location data and is widely used for IP Geolocation.
  • Usage: Free access with some limitations, paid GeoIP2 services for more comprehensive data.

4. Abstract IP Geolocation API:

  • Features: Offers IP Geolocation data including city, country, latitude, and longitude.
  • Usage: Completely free with no restrictions on requests.

Getting Started with Free IP Geolocation APIs

Here are the steps to get started with a free IP Geolocation API:

1. Sign Up:

  • For most free IP Geolocation APIs, you'll need to sign up for an API key. This key is essential for authenticating your requests to the API.

2. Select an API:

3. Retrieve Location Data:

  • Use your API key to make HTTP requests to the API endpoint. The API will respond with location data for the provided IP address.

4. Integrate with Your Application:

  • Integrate the location data into your web application, mobile app, or service to enhance user experiences or bolster security measures.

Conclusion

Free IP Geolocation APIs provide a valuable entry point into the world of location-based services, offering insights, personalization, and security enhancements without the need for a significant financial investment. Whether you're a developer looking to experiment with IP Geolocation or a business aiming to enhance user experiences, free IP Geolocation APIs offer a cost-effective way to tap into the power of location data. So, explore the options, choose the one that fits your requirements, and start leveraging the benefits of IP Geolocation today.

In case you have found a mistake in the text, please send a message to the author by selecting the mistake and pressing Ctrl-Enter.
Comments (0)

    No comments yet

You must be logged in to comment.

Sign In